The Charlotte Hornets are bringing back the double pinstripes.
Charlotte unveiled its new association and icon uniforms ahead of the 2020-21 campaign on Monday. The primary uniforms will be white jerseys with teal pinstripes and teal jerseys with white pinstripes.

When the Bobcats rebranded in 2014, they kept the original teal and purple color scheme of the first iteration of the Hornets. However, the uniform designs strayed from the original, and fans have been calling for the Hornets to bring back the pinstripes ever since.
The Hornets wore replicas of the original uniforms for a few games each of the past three seasons, and they became very popular. The new design pays homage to the classic look, much to fans delight.
The new-look jerseys will be available for retail purchase on Oct. 1. Charlotte also is expected to unveil a new city edition uniform later during the offseason.
